Description
PAUL FOLLOT (1877-1941). Six stained oak chairs with slightly enveloping medallion backs, front legs with a gadrooned bulge at the top and tapering chained bodies, sabre backs. Backs and seats upholstered in worn grey and blue velvet (accidents, missing parts, missing veneer).
Height 91 cm - Length 48 cm - Depth 43 cm
Provenance: former Paul Follot collection, now in the family.
Bibliography:
Léopold Diego Sanchez, Paul Follot, un artiste décorateur parisien, AAM éditions, Brussels, 2020, pp. 85 and 110 for a variant of a chair with a base similar to our models.
